Culture, Media and Sport (including Topical Questions)
MPs question a government minister
Oral questions to the Secretary of State for Culture, Media and Sport, including topical questions on issues affecting the cultural, media, and sporting sectors. This is a regular accountability mechanism where MPs quiz ministers on departmental policy, funding decisions, and sector challenges.
Culture, media, and sport affect millions of people as audiences, participants, workers, and consumers. These questions hold the government to account on issues ranging from arts funding and public broadcasting to sports governance, gambling regulation, and creative industry support—areas that touch employment, local economies, and public wellbeing.
